Caustic potash was traditionally used in conjunction with animal fats to produce soft soaps, one of the caustic processes that rendered soaps from fats in the process of saponification, one known since antiquity. Plant potash lent the name to the element potassium, which was first derived from caustic potash, and also gave potassium its chemical symbol K (from the German name Kalium), which ultimately derived from alkali. Muriatic acid for industrial purposes typically is 20 to 35 percent hydrochloric acid, while muriatic acid for household purposes ranges between 10 and 12 percent hydrochloric acid. Sodium and calcium hypochlorite are common ingredients in household bleach and pool chlorinating solution.
